one. Professional medical Electronic ICs:

Clinical Electronic Integrated Circuits (ICs) are specialised semiconductor devices made to meet the stringent needs of health care programs. These ICs are engineered to deliver superior performance, precision, and dependability, creating them ideal for use in significant healthcare equipment including affected person monitors, defibrillators, infusion pumps, and professional medical imaging devices.

From the professional medical area, precision and regularity are paramount, and Clinical Electronic ICs are tailored to deliver precise analog and digital sign processing, sensor interfacing, electric power administration, and interaction abilities. They endure rigorous testing and certification procedures to be certain compliance with sector specifications and polices, like ISO 13485 and IEC 60601, governing the safety and usefulness of medical units.

2. Microcontrollers:

Microcontrollers are compact built-in circuits that include a central processing device (CPU), memory, input/output ports, and various peripherals into an individual chip. In health-related electronics, microcontrollers function the "brains" of assorted gadgets, supplying the computational power and Management essential for device operation and operation.

Healthcare units usually demand serious-time info processing, sensor integration, person interface control, and communication capabilities, all of which may be efficiently managed by microcontrollers. No matter if It really is checking critical signs, administering therapy, or controlling product parameters, microcontrollers help precise Manage and automation, improving the effectiveness and value of health care products.

three. Monolithic ICs:

Monolithic Built-in Circuits (ICs) are semiconductor units fabricated on only one silicon wafer, where by all components, which includes transistors, resistors, capacitors, and interconnections, are integrated into a single chip. In the professional medical industry, monolithic ICs obtain apps in a variety of clinical equipment, including implantable healthcare devices, diagnostic machines, and wearable wellbeing screens.

The compact dimensions, lower electricity consumption, and high dependability of monolithic ICs make them effectively-suited for healthcare purposes wherever Room, power performance, and durability are significant issues. No matter whether It is designing miniaturized implantable products or portable diagnostic instruments, monolithic ICs allow the event of Innovative medical alternatives that increase patient outcomes and Standard of living.
